Synopsis
Peep! Peep! All Aboard!! Thomas and his friends would like to wish all of you a very Merry Christmas. In this special collection of both new stories and seasonal favorites, you'll experience first hand the joy and magic the holiday season brings to the island of sodor. In the All-new story "snow", join in on the fun as rusty tells the story of when skarloey was up to his funnel in snow. Cheer on Thomas, Harold, Percy and Terence as they shovel out stranded villagers just in time for christmas, and help the engines find thomas just in the nick of time for the big yuletide celebration.
Amazon.com
Thomas and his train-yard pals wouldn't pout if Christmases on the Island of Sodor were a little less white. In each of the six story stops that make up Thomas' Christmas Wonderland, snow stalls or otherwise threatens to sabotage the perky cargo pullers' holiday plans. Everybody's stuck in Snow, a new story narrated by Alec Baldwin, so Rusty lifts his fellow locomotives' spirits by relating the tale of the year Skarloey was sidelined by an avalanche. In "Thomas & the Missing Christmas Tree," Thomas is enlisted to pick up the village tree when severe snowdrifts leave him stranded on a remote stretch of track. The title character in the "Terence the Tractor" segment teaches a teary-eyed Thomas a thing or two about how his "ugly" Caterpillar wheels come in handy when the uncharacteristically arrogant engine sets off without his snowplow. And in "Special Funnel," Peter Sam is relieved of the other engines' constant ribbing when he's rewarded with a deluxe-model funnel after a monster icicle snaps his formerly wobbly one off. Rounding out this festive feature is "The Snow Song," a musical chug through decked-out village station stops that celebrates the title character's pluck: the little blue train finds his way "Whistle blowing / Yes, it's snowing." Fans of the series ought to waste no time climbing aboard, and newcomers will be relieved to discover a well-rounded introduction to a range of train-yard friends. Ages 3 to 6. --Tammy La Gorce
